Broccoli with Creamy Cheese

2 Porsi

Bahan

Bahan-bahan:

  • 2 golden potato
  • 1 batang brokoli

Saus Keju:

  • 1 sdm mentega
  • 125 ml air
  • 4 sdm FiberCreme
  • 1 sachet bubuk keju
  • 100 gr keju parut quick melt
  • garam merica secukupnya
  • campuran air + maizena jika ingin kental

 

Cara Membuat

Kentang Panggang:

  1. Panggang kentang dengan diolesi minyak dan beri lada dan garam.
  2. Lalu panggang 30 menit atau sampai fork tender.

Saus Keju:

  1. Tuang air, bubuk keju dan FiberCreme, panaskan hingga mendidih sambil diaduk hingga tercampur rata, kecilkan api.
  2. Beri keju aduk terus sampai keju larut.
  3. Beri garam dan merica sesuai selera.
  4. Beri campuran maizena jika ingin kental lalu terakhir masukan mentega dan aduk rata.

Broccoli:

  1. Didihkan air dan masukkan garam. Rebus brokoli selama 1 menit.
  2. Tata brokoli di atas kentang dan lumuri dengan saus keju.
